WebAt rest, a normal heart rate should be 60 to 100 beats per minute. In atrial fibrillation, the heart rate can often be considerably higher than 100 beats per minute, and each individual beat is erratic. Pericarditis is classically associated with ECG … WebJun 13, 2024 · One of the easiest ways to calculate heart rate on a 6 second strip is to count the amount of R waves on a 6 second strip and and multiply it by 10. This can be done if a heart rhythm is regular or irregular. To determine if …

WebThe older CHADS 2 Score was designed to identify “high risk” patients for warfarin, but many common (and important) stroke risk factors in AF are not included within the CHADS 2. CHA₂DS₂-VASc was developed to be more inclusive of common stroke risk factors/modifiers. Numerous validation studies have shown that CHA 2 DS 2 -VASc is as ...

The major difference between a-fib and a-flutter are the saw-tooth waves in a-flutter and that in a-fib the r-waves are always irregular. The r-waves in a-flutter can be regular or irregular.
